
Building An Agentic AI Governance And Risk Management Strategy For Enterprises
Enterprise AI is entering a new phase. While earlier tools waited for a prompt and returned an answer, autonomous agents now make decisions and act across business systems on their own. Adoption is already moving fast, but with it come new challenges.
For instance, Cisco’s 2025 AI Readiness Index report found that more than four out of five organizations (83 percent) plan to deploy AI agents, with 40 percent expecting these to work alongside employees before the end of 2026. However, only a third say they are fully equipped to secure and control these tools.
This leaves many companies vulnerable. Agentic AI security is now a must-have for managing the new attack surfaces these systems create. On its own, though, it is not enough. Technical controls cannot answer who approved an agent, what it may do or who is accountable when it goes wrong. A clear governance and risk management strategy underpins an effective response.
Why Agent Autonomy Demands A New Governance Approach

Traditional IT systems are intended to be predictable. They follow fixed rules, act when a person triggers them and produce repeatable results. Autonomous agents work differently. They interpret goals, choose their own steps and act across systems without a human approving each one.
This autonomy breaks the assumptions typical approaches to governance are built on. An agent can reach a decision no one signed off, take an action no policy anticipated and do so in ways that cannot always be explained after the fact. For compliance and data protection teams, this is a serious problem. While regulations demand accountability and a clear audit trail, an agent’s reasoning is often opaque, especially when using so-called ‘black box’ AIs.
Governance for these systems therefore means more than managing data and access. It demands solutions that can control behavior, setting boundaries on what an agent may decide and do, and ensuring every action can be traced to an accountable owner.
The Cost Of Ungoverned Agent Adoption
Left uncontrolled, AI agents may drift. Over time they can shift how they interpret goals or data, making choices that no longer match what the business intended. If tools have unfettered access to key systems, a single flawed or manipulated agent can act far beyond its remit. That exposure widens further under external threats such as adversarial AI attacks and jailbreaking, which turn an agent against its owner.
Consider, for example, a procurement agent granted broad access to approve orders. A drift in how it reads supplier data, or a jailbreak that removes its limits, could see it approve fraudulent payments for weeks before anyone notices.
Other risks may include a ‘domino effect’, where faulty reasoning from one AI agent propagates to others throughout a business. What’s more, if something unexpected does occur, there may be few audit trails to determine exactly what went wrong and why.
The consequences can be severe, with risks such as financial loss, data breaches, regulatory penalties and lasting reputational damage all awaiting businesses that fail to adopt effective risk management for their AI tools. Because ungoverned agents operate with little oversight, the harm often compounds quietly, surfacing only once it is significant enough to force attention.
The Building Blocks Of Agentic AI Governance
Effective governance rests on several connected building blocks. Together, the following elements help create a comprehensive risk management framework that keeps the use of autonomous AIs under control:
- Governance framework: A defined structure sets out how agents are approved, deployed and overseen, ideally aligned to recognized standards such as the NIST AI Risk Management Framework and ISO/IEC 42001. Without it, oversight becomes inconsistent and ad hoc.
- Compliance mapping: Agent use must be mapped to legal and industry obligations, such as those set by the EU AI Act, so deployments meet regulatory standards from the outset rather than being retrofitted after a problem.
- Policy enforcement: Written rules must be turned into technical controls that constrain what agents can actually do, since policy alone cannot restrain an autonomous system acting at machine speed.
- Risk assessment: Each agent’s potential impact should be evaluated before deployment and reviewed at regular intervals afterward, focusing the heaviest oversight on the agents whose reach and autonomy pose the greatest risk.
- Ownership and accountability: Every agent needs a named owner responsible for its behavior, so that when a decision or action causes harm, it can always be traced back to an accountable person.
Building these controls in as early as possible is what separates safe adoption from costly disruption. Businesses that embed governance into their AI security posture before agents scale can grow their use of AI with confidence, knowing each new agent is approved, constrained and accountable from day one. Those that delay will be left reacting after the fact, discovering gaps only once the damage is done. By then the consequences can be severe, from breached data and regulatory penalties to financial loss and lasting damage to customer trust.
Agentic AI Governance FAQs
What is agentic AI governance?
Agentic AI governance is the set of frameworks, policies and controls that determine how autonomous agents are approved, deployed and overseen. It governs not just data and access but agent behavior and accountability.
Why do enterprises need an AI governance strategy?
Because agents act autonomously and at speed, they can make unapproved or unexplainable decisions. A governance strategy keeps their behavior accountable, compliant and aligned with what the business actually intended.
How can organizations manage risks associated with autonomous AI agents?
Risk is managed by assessing each agent’s impact before deployment, enforcing least-privilege access, monitoring behavior continuously and assigning a named owner accountable for every agent in use.
What policies should be included in an agentic AI governance framework?
Key policies cover which agents may be deployed and for what purpose, the data and actions each may access, where human approval is required and how compliance obligations are met.
How does shadow AI affect AI governance?
Shadow AI undermines governance because unsanctioned agents operate outside oversight. They cannot be assessed, monitored or controlled, creating blind spots where risk builds unseen until an incident forces it into view.
